> I tried running python2 -3 on some code, and found numpy > produces a lot of warnings. > > Many like: > python -3 -c 'import numpy' > ... > /usr/lib64/python2.7/site-packages/numpy/lib/polynomial.py:928: > DeprecationWarning: Overriding __eq__ blocks inheritance of __hash__ in 3.x > > But also: > /usr/lib64/python2.7/site-packages/numpy/lib/shape_base.py:838: > DeprecationWarning: classic int division > n /= max(dim_in,1) > > Some of these are bogus. ``` DeprecationWarning: CObject type is not supported in 3.x. Please use capsule objects instead. ``` Capsule objects aren't available in 2.6 and we don't use them for any of the 2.x Python series, only for 3.x. The `__hash__` being blocked hasn't seemed to be a problem, but we should probably fix it anyway. Chuck
